Detailed Analysis of Key Features:

Engine and Transmission:

The Moto Custom 400cc’s 400cc, single-cylinder, air-cooled engine is a workhorse, delivering smooth power delivery and a satisfyingly linear throttle response. The engine’s simplicity and reliability make it easy to maintain and repair. The 5-speed transmission provides a good spread of gears for city riding and cruising on open roads. While the engine may not be as powerful as some of its competitors, it offers a comfortable and enjoyable riding experience.

Suspension and Handling:

The Moto Custom 400cc’s suspension is tuned for comfort, absorbing bumps and imperfections in the road effectively. The telescopic front forks and twin rear shock absorbers provide a smooth and controlled ride, even on rough surfaces. The bike’s low center of gravity and balanced weight distribution contribute to stable handling, making it easy to maneuver in tight spaces and navigate winding roads.

Brakes:

The Moto Custom 400cc is equipped with disc brakes front and rear, providing adequate stopping power for a motorcycle of its size. While the brakes are not as powerful as some of its competitors, they offer a predictable and reliable braking experience.

Fuel Tank Capacity and Range:

The Moto Custom 400cc has a fuel tank capacity of 14 liters, providing a decent range between fill-ups. The bike’s fuel efficiency, combined with its relatively small tank, allows for frequent stops at gas stations.

Seat Height and Comfort:

The Moto Custom 400cc has a seat height of 780mm, making it accessible to riders of different heights. The single seat is designed for comfort, offering enough space and padding for long rides. The wide handlebars provide good leverage, making it easy to control the bike and maintain a comfortable riding position.

Weight and Dimensions:

The Moto Custom 400cc weighs 155kg (dry), making it a relatively lightweight motorcycle. Its compact dimensions and low center of gravity make it easy to maneuver in tight spaces and navigate winding roads.
